Why liquidity fragmentation Continues to Disrupt Web3 Growth
The concept of liquidity fragmentation refers to capital being scattered across multiple networks, applications, and marketplaces. Instead of existing within a connected environment, liquidity becomes isolated in separate pools that cannot efficiently support one another.
This separation creates barriers for users attempting to access the best available trading conditions. Even when significant liquidity exists throughout the broader ecosystem, individual markets may struggle with limited depth because resources are divided. The result is reduced efficiency and a less seamless experience for participants.

Market Efficiency Suffers When Capital Becomes Isolated
Healthy markets depend on accessible liquidity that supports consistent asset exchange. liquidity fragmentation weakens this foundation by dividing available capital into disconnected segments.
When liquidity is dispersed, users may encounter larger price variations and less predictable transaction outcomes. Even relatively modest trading activity can create greater market impact because individual liquidity pools lack sufficient depth. These inefficiencies affect both experienced participants and newcomers.
